Output 00dd17ae92b822c499c2035cde7e56acc4c125856f9df77eeae12472c285d33f: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d04469ad898733e7668d2520145636860900a42 OP_EQUAL
address
3BdShYLStca8J7jstXefQ13zudhhc8fhR6
transaction
00dd17ae92b822c499c2035cde7e56acc4c125856f9df77eeae12472c285d33f
spent
true